About the Role

Our client is looking for a strong IT Workplace Technology Engineer to help build and evolve a modern, secure, and scalable digital workplace. You will take ownership of device management, collaboration tooling, identity workflows, automation, and endpoint security controls, ensuring employees have a seamless and secure technology experience.

This role is hands-on and sits at the intersection of IT, Security, and Employee Experience, with strong emphasis on Intune, Jamf, Zero Trust, networking, and automation.

Key Responsibilities

  • Lead administration and lifecycle management of MDM platforms (Microsoft Intune, Jamf Pro) across macOS, Windows, and mobile devices.
  • Manage and enhance enterprise collaboration tools: Google Workspace, Slack, Atlassian (Jira/Confluence).
  • Implement and maintain endpoint security controls, including Conditional Access, Device Trust, Network Trust, DLP, CASB, and Secure Web Gateways.
  • Own and optimise the corporate Wi-Fi/network stack for office environments.
  • Build automation using PowerShell, Bash, or Python, and support Infrastructure as Code (IaC) workflows.
  • Integrate identity and access management processes using Okta, applying Zero Trust principles.
  • Define standards for device provisioning, compliance, patching, and onboarding/offboarding.
  • Serve as the final escalation point for complex endpoint issues and provide mentorship to IT team members.
  • Support and lead workplace IT projects, ensuring reliability, security, and strong employee experience.
